📋 Nutrition Summary
With 159.9 calories per serving (1 Serving (28.0g)), Unsalted Roasted Cashews is a moderately calorie-dense food worth tracking if you're managing your intake. The majority of its calories come from fat (14.0g, 70.8% of calories), including 2.5g of saturated fat.

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Unsalted Roasted Cashews
Is Unsalted Roasted Cashews good for weight loss?
Cashews are calorie-dense at 160 calories per ounce, so portion control matters if you're watching intake. However, their protein and fiber content can help you feel satisfied on smaller servings, and the unsalted variety avoids extra sodium that might trigger water retention.
Is Unsalted Roasted Cashews a good snack for kids?
Roasted cashews make an excellent snack for kids—they're satisfying, nutrient-dense, and have no added salt or sugar. Just watch portion sizes since they're easy to overeat, and ensure your child can chew them safely if they're very young.
What diets does Unsalted Roasted Cashews suit?
These work well for paleo, keto (in moderation), vegan, vegetarian, and whole-food diets. They're also suitable for nut-friendly low-sodium eating plans since they're unsalted.
What does Unsalted Roasted Cashews pair well with for a balanced meal?
Pair them with fresh fruit like apples or berries for balanced carbs, add them to salads with leafy greens and a protein like chicken, or combine with whole grains and vegetables for a complete snack bowl.
How does Unsalted Roasted Cashews fit into a balanced diet?
Cashews contribute healthy monounsaturated fats, plant-based protein, and minerals like iron and potassium that support energy and bone health. A small handful fits naturally into a balanced diet when combined with whole grains, vegetables, and lean proteins to round out the carbohydrate and nutrient profile.
